Stephanie's Ham & Cheese Strata Recipe

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
1. One loaf bread (soft whole wheat works well)
2. 6 eggs (I usually use 3 eggs and egg beaters combined )
3. 1 tsp. dry mustard
4. 1 tsp. onion powder
5. 1 tsp. white pepper
6. 2 1/2 cups milk (1 or 2 %)
7. 1 cup grated Cheddar cheese
8. 2/3 cup grated Swiss cheese
9. 1 cup cup chopped ham (you may use Canadian bacon if you prefer)
10. 1 stick margarine, melted
11. 2 cups cornflake crumbs (i use Kelloggs, found in the baking aisle in the market or you can grind your own)

Directions:
Directions:
Put 6 slices bread in a buttered (or spray with PAM) 9 x 13 inch glass pan. Mix the cheeses and ham together. Spread over the bread in the pan. Place another layer of six slices bread on top. Whisk together eggs, milk and spices, blending thoroughly. carefully poi over the layered bread and cover with foil. Refrigerate over night. Next morning, remove pan from fridge and let sit out for about 30 minutes at room temperature. Preheat over to 350 degrees. Melt margarine in a saucepan, add cornflake crumbs, blend well. Spread over the top of bread and bake uncovered for 45 minutes on middle rack in oven.

Number Of Servings:
Number Of Servings:
6-8
Preparation Time:
Preparation Time:
30 minutes plus baking
